Second Plymouth Restaurant Week a Delicious Treat for Diners

10 downtown Plymouth restaurants will cook up fixed price three-course menus over nine days.

From the Penn Grill’s Braised Pork Enchiladas to Nico & Vali’s Risotto with Trout Filet, there’s a taste to satisfy every appetite over the next nine days as the second annual Plymouth Restaurant Week kicks off.

The event starts Friday and will run through Oct. 5. 

Over the next few days, 10 Plymouth restaurants will offer price fixed three-course lunch and dinner menus for $15, $25, or $35 per person. All of the participating restaurants are within walking distance of one another.

Plymouth is a community recognized for its downtown, which has a well-earned culinary reputation.  

“With our fantastic restaurants being one of the best draws to our community, it’s great to see some of our downtown restaurants teaming up to showcase the quality of their fare,” Wes Graff, President of the Plymouth Community Chamber of Commerce said in a news release.

Participating restaurants include: 
Compari’s on the Park
E.G. Nick’s
Fiamma Grille
Ironwood Grill
Nico and Vali
Panache
Penn Grill
The Sardine Room
Sean O’Callaghan’s
Zin Wine Bar Restaurant

Beverages, gratuity and taxes are not included in the rate. No tickets or passes are necessary, and diners can participate as frequently as they wish over the nine-day period. While advance reservations are not required, they are strongly encouraged by contacting participating restaurants directly.
